November construction newsletter

11/4/2024

 
Secord and Smallwood work sites suspended work at the end of October. The crews demobilized equipment as work was completed. FLTF will continue to monitor the three suspended dams with safety inspections. Sanford work will continue until the end of January. The crew will complete Phase 2 of the cofferdam before fully suspending work.
​
This will be our last construction update until construction restarts, hopefully in spring of 2025.

October Construction Newsletter

10/7/2024

 
Secord and Smallwood are demobilizing crews in preparation for the upcoming suspension this month. The crews are ensuring that the dam is in a safe and stable condition while the litigation surrounding the appeal continues. We have an updated completion date graphic on our dams page. Meanwhile, Sanford work continues until January. The crew is pouring concrete in the powerhouse, low level outlet and the retaining walls. September Construction Newsletter

9/19/2024

 
The suspension schedule is highlighted in the latest construction newsletter. Edenville construction is already suspended, with Smallwood following in September, Secord in October, and Sanford in January. We continue to work through the Michigan Court of Appeals case and hope crews can get back to work again in the spring/summer of 2025.

August Construction Newsletter

8/15/2024

 
The work at Edenville is suspended but it remains in safe and stable condition. Second, Smallwood and Sanford work continues according to their suspension plans. Each of the three dams is working on erecting formwork and pouring concrete. Read more in the construction news.

July Construction Update: Secord and Smallwood Dams

7/25/2023

 
In July we placed concrete and achieved 95% installation completion of the Secord steel sheet pile auxiliary spillway among other things. These activities are closely monitored by the project team to ensure a durable final product.
